Utterly brilliant film. Frank Darabont's second Stephen King adaptation. He followed The Green Mile with The Mist, and preceeded it with what I and many, many people refer to as the greatest film of all time, The Shawshank Redemption.

In that case, MJJ, I would recommend to you:
- The Mist
- The Night Flier
- The Shining (outstanding Kubrick film that King despises)
- Creepshow (screenplay written by King, and he acts in it)
- Christine
- Children of the Corn
- It
- Thinner
- The Langoliers
- The Stand
- The Dark Half
- Pet Sematary
- Misery
- Stand By Me
- Salem's Lot
I suggest watching all of them. They're awesome.
